~ Niranjan On Sunday, March 16, 2014 10:52:19 PM UTC+5:30, Niranjan U wrote: > > Hi, > > I have attached an image representation of node relationships in my graph. > > Basically, I have users who like different geographies (could be a > country, state or city) and I want to match those users who like > geographies in the same country. > For eg. if user A likes USA > user B likes USA > user C likes San Jose > user D likes France > > then I want user A to be matched to users B and C. > > What cypher query will get me the results? This is what I tried: > > /** node id of user A is 0 **/ > > START u=node(0) MATCH (u:users) - [:likes] - (g1) - [:contains*0..5] - > (g2) - [:likes] - (o:users) RETURN o; > > This query is not working as expected.
